Quality Manager - Eau Claire Michigan

Company: MBP Co LLC
Location: Eau Claire, Michigan
Posted On: 04/23/2024

Summary:The Quality Specialist s primary responsibilities are to assist the Quality department in the oversight of all quality control documentation, including that required of Food Safety and Quality System (FSQS) and the Safe Quality Foods (SQF) system. Other responsibilities include, but are not limited to, the following principal dutiesPrinciple Duties:Daily verification and maintenance of production records including:CCP (Metal Detector) Monitoring LogsSifter Monitoring LogsWetting Slurry Temperature LogsDaily maintenance of Product Release Records.Verification and maintenance of Facility Operational Inspections.Enters completed maintenance Work Orders into the appropriate logs.Manage the Positive Release System including the creation of Certificate of Analyses (CoAs) and release of finished product.Verifies files, and maintains calibration and laboratory records including:Titratable Acidity logsMicro resultsAir and Water Quality Monitoring logsTransfers required documents and data to the BOX system. Is the main interface with the BOX system and is fluent with its use.Creates Certificates of Conformance (CoC) documents when required by customers.Assists with the New Product Development (NPD) process and completes associated documents including:Packaging Work Instructions (PWI)Product SpecificationsMaintains the Supplier Approval Register and all related supplier documentation and forms.Assists with the training program by:Generating and uploading the training rosters.Filing and recording training tests.Maintaining the Training Register.Assists with the Sanitation program by:Generating the monthly Master Sanitation Schedules.Entering sanitation data into the Master Sanitation Schedule Matrix and calculating scores.Filing all related paperwork.Prepares needed blank production forms for the Production personnel.Participates in Internal and External audits in the role of documentarian.Assists QA department by managing the Corrective Action/Preventative Action (CAPA) program by:Assigning numbers and CAPAs to responsible parties.Tracking progress of CAPA work.Recording/filing completed CAPAs on appropriate log.Will be a member of the Self Inspection Team (SIT) and the Food Safety Team (FST).Assist in all other duties assigned by management.The requirements outlined in the company s guidelines for Food Safety and Quality System are communicated through all levels within the organization. All employees are responsible for adhering to these standards. Employees are responsible for identifying and reporting issues that could affect food safety and quality.Actively participates in customer complaint investigation and resolution.General Requirements:Proficient in Microsoft Word, Excel, and Outlook software. Must be able to quickly learn other informational systems as needed.Must be a high school graduate. Some college education is a plus.Minimum of two years experience in the Food Industry or Third-Party Laboratory environment.Follow company policies, safety program, SOPs, GMPs and Food Safety (HACCP) procedures.Be employed by the supplier as a company employee on a full-time basis.
